<?xml version="1.0"?>
<!--
/**
 * Copyright © Magento, Inc. All rights reserved.
 * See COPYING.txt for license details.
 */
-->
<page xmlns:xsi="http://www.w3.org/2001/XMLSchema-instance" xsi:noNamespaceSchemaLocation="urn:magento:framework:View/Layout/etc/page_configuration.xsd">
    <body>
        <referenceBlock name="adminhtml.system.variable.grid.container">
            <block class="Magento\Backend\Block\Widget\Grid" name="adminhtml.system.variable.grid" as="grid">
                <arguments>
                    <argument name="id" xsi:type="string">customVariablesGrid</argument>
                    <argument name="dataSource" xsi:type="object" shared="false">Magento\Variable\Model\ResourceModel\Variable\Collection</argument>
                    <argument name="default_sort" xsi:type="string">variable_id</argument>
                    <argument name="default_dir" xsi:type="string">ASC</argument>
                </arguments>
                <block class="Magento\Backend\Block\Widget\Grid\ColumnSet" name="adminhtml.system.variable.grid.columnSet" as="grid.columnSet">
                    <arguments>
                        <argument name="rowUrl" xsi:type="array">
                            <item name="path" xsi:type="string">adminhtml/*/edit</item>
                            <item name="extraParamsTemplate" xsi:type="array">
                                <item name="variable_id" xsi:type="string">getId</item>
                            </item>
                        </argument>
                    </arguments>
                    <block class="Magento\Backend\Block\Widget\Grid\Column" name="adminhtml.system.variable.grid.columnSet.variable_id" as="variable_id">
                        <arguments>
                            <argument name="header" xsi:type="string" translate="true">Variable ID</argument>
                            <argument name="index" xsi:type="string">variable_id</argument>
                            <argument name="column_css_class" xsi:type="string">col-id</argument>
                            <argument name="header_css_class" xsi:type="string">col-id</argument>
                        </arguments>
                    </block>
                    <block class="Magento\Backend\Block\Widget\Grid\Column" name="adminhtml.system.variable.grid.columnSet.code" as="code">
                        <arguments>
                            <argument name="header" xsi:type="string" translate="true">Variable Code</argument>
                            <argument name="index" xsi:type="string">code</argument>
                        </arguments>
                    </block>
                    <block class="Magento\Backend\Block\Widget\Grid\Column" name="adminhtml.system.variable.grid.columnSet.name" as="name">
                        <arguments>
                            <argument name="header" xsi:type="string" translate="true">Name</argument>
                            <argument name="index" xsi:type="string">name</argument>
                        </arguments>
                    </block>
                </block>
            </block>
        </referenceBlock>
    </body>
</page>
